Sometimes the non-functioning frequency valve can be as simple as a bad connection with the connector plug to the valve. Take the connector off and put it back on a few times and see if that helps. Another thing that can stop it from buzzing is if the mixture is WAY off. A stuck plunger in the mixture unit can do that. A bad Lambda relay can prevent power getting to the Lambda ECU and running the frequency valve. If you are getting a reading, any reading at all, on your dwell meter, it means the ECU is getting power and the relays are not the problem. Without the frequency valve buzzing, it is not adding any fuel to make the A/F ratio correct so you are running very lean, that's why you don't have any power and it won't idle. The mixture screw sets the base mixture and the frequency valve adds what is necessary to get the correct mixture. Do not try to adjust the mixture screw to "fix" this. Get the frequency valve to buzz. Is the muffler getting red hot? That means the mixture is WAY too rich and the plunger is stuck. If the muffler isn't red hot you are running too lean and the plunger isn't stuck but the frequency valve isn't working, it's probably an electrical problem. There is a small ground wire that goes to the intake manifold to ground the frequency valve. See if you knocked it loose.

Frequency valve should buzz regardless of O2 sensor.
If O2 sensor isn't connected, the Lambda ECU can't go into closed loop and will hold the frequency valve at a set duty cycle. You should still hear the frequency valve buzzing, and the dwell reading will be steady and high.
Test the coil of the frequency valve. With the connector unplugged, you should see a reading between 2-3 ohms between the two pins. Anything above or below indicates bad valve.
If your valve passes the test, verify the connections are good. Then, with the car on, backprobe the frequency valve, test and verify
-Battery voltage on Red/Purple wire
-Pulses on Red/Brown Wire
you may need a logic probe to see the pulses. DVOM or test light may not work. Harbor Freight has one for $10
If you're missing battery voltage, issue is with the Lambda relay, or the wiring to/from Lambda Relay
If you're missing pulses, or pulses are weak, issue is with the Lambda ECU
If you need to check the ECU, remove the shell on the ECU connector and verify with car running:
-Battery Voltage at PIN 8, Grn/Yellow. No Voltage? Lambda Relay or wiring
-Ground at PINS 5 and 16, Black. No Ground? wiring
-Pulses at PIN 15, Rd/Brown. No Pulse, or weak pulses? Bad ECU
-You can also test feedback from 02 sensor at PIN 2. Should be between 0-1VDC between PIN 2 and Ground with the engine at operating temp

So, to set mixture properly, the idle issue needs to be solved. Service manual tells us that idle needs to be raised to 950ish to check mixture using a dwell meter. You can back the idle down to spec after mixture is set. The accuracy of the mixture setting is contingent upon everything else being right, and having a good O2 sensor, if we're using a dwell meter.
if you're using Dave McKeen's idle ecu, you won't set idle speed with the screws anymore, FYI. You will need to get the throttle linkage issue sorted out, however. Sounds like you might need to pull the throttle body, and check that the ball stud is tight on the crank. There's a spring retaining plate behind the crank that gets wallowed out on the throttle shaft, too. Make sure all these parts are tight, a ball peen hammer will help. You can't have any slop in that linkage if you want a predictable idle. You may also want to verify that your idle speed thermistor is good.

You don't just twiddle those screws. There is a procedure. If you don't have them right you can damage the throttle shaft, the stop screw is supposed to prevent you from overforcing the throttle shaft once the butterfly plates are closed. Then you set the idle switch so it just trips and not depress it any further or you damage the microswitch. There is a nice write up of the procedure somewhere.
